Anthropic Introduces Dynamic Workflows to Power Large-Scale AI Tasks
-

Alongside the launch of Claude Opus 4.8, Anthropic announced a new research-preview feature called Dynamic Workflows, designed to help AI systems coordinate complex tasks using hundreds of parallel sub-agents.The system aims to improve how large AI models manage long-running projects, particularly software development and code migrations involving massive codebases. According to Anthropic, Opus 4.8 paired with Dynamic Workflows can handle large-scale engineering tasks from planning through deployment while continuously evaluating results against existing test suites.
Anthropic also hinted that its more advanced Mythos model could arrive in the coming weeks once additional safety safeguards are completed. The company continues to position itself as a leader in enterprise AI, focusing on reliability, reasoning, and large-scale autonomous workflows.
